X277 WYA is a 2000 Nissan 200 SX in Black with a 1,998c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 11 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 72.7%.
Across all 2000 Nissan 200 SX models, the average MOT pass rate is 74.6% with a typical mileage of 81,316 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Nissan 200 SX fails its MOT is suspension component mounting prescribed area is excessively corroded, accounting for 5,770 recorded failures. If you're considering buying X277 WYA,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Nissan 200 SX typically stays on UK roads for around 37 years. At 26 years old, this Nissan 200 SX is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
